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: Patients had undergone previous cardiac surgery, including mitral valve surgery, aortic valve surgery, combined mitral and aortic valve surgery (double valve surgery, DVS), co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G), congenital heart disease surgery, and have developed new mitral valve disease requiring surgical treatment, such as bioprosthetic valve failure, mechanical valve dysfunction, infective endocarditis, mitral valve perivalvular leak, recurrent dysfunction after mitral valvuloplasty, and new onset of severe mitral valve regurgitation or stenosis.

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: 1. Patients who have undergone aortic surgery; 2. Patients requiring concurrent aortic surgery, aortic valve surgery or CABG; 3.Preoperatively hemodynamically unstable.
